10 Hábitos Que Todo Programador Debería Practicar (¡Desde Hoy!)

Fazt
25 Jun 202507:20

Summary

TLDREste video ofrece 10 hábitos esenciales para mejorar la rutina de cualquier programador, desde organizar el espacio de trabajo hasta celebrar los logros, por pequeños que sean. Se destacan prácticas como planificar tareas diarias, tomar descansos regulares, mantener el entorno digital limpio y aprender de otros códigos. Además, se recomienda utilizar herramientas como Chatle LM y Devin para mejorar la productividad y automatizar procesos. Estos hábitos sencillos, pero efectivos, pueden transformar la forma en que aprendes y trabajas como desarrollador, ayudando a avanzar de manera constante y organizada.

Takeaways

  • 😀 Organiza tu espacio de trabajo: Tener un lugar específico para programar ayuda a asociar ese espacio con la concentración y el enfoque.
  • 😀 Prepara tu lista de tareas antes de comenzar: Dedica unos minutos a escribir las tareas más importantes del día para mantenerte enfocado.
  • 😀 Programa descansos: Tomar descansos breves ayuda a mejorar la concentración y previene el agotamiento mental y físico.
  • 😀 Mantén tu escritorio digital ordenado: Al igual que el espacio físico, un escritorio digital limpio mejora la productividad al reducir distracciones.
  • 😀 Haz algo pequeño todos los días: Aunque no siempre construirás un gran proyecto, avanzar de manera constante, aunque sea en pequeñas tareas, es clave para lograr tus metas.
  • 😀 Revisa y limpia tu código: Antes de terminar, revisa tu código, elimina líneas innecesarias y organiza tus funciones para mejorar la comprensión y aprendizaje.
  • 😀 Toma notas de lo que aprendes: Escribe conceptos nuevos y errores comunes para poder referirte a ellos fácilmente y mejorar tu memoria y aplicación.
  • 😀 Aprende atajos de teclado en tu editor: Practicar los atajos de teclado te ayudará a trabajar de manera más eficiente y ahorrar tiempo.
  • 😀 Practica leer el código de otros: Analizar proyectos ajenos te permite aprender nuevas soluciones y estilos para enriquecer tu propio enfoque.
  • 😀 Celebra tus logros: Reconocer cada pequeño avance te motiva, te ayuda a mantenerte positivo y reduce el síndrome del impostor.

Q & A

  • ¿Por qué es importante organizar tu espacio de trabajo?

    -Organizar tu espacio de trabajo ayuda a asociar ese lugar con la productividad, mejorando la concentración. Un espacio limpio y ordenado facilita la concentración, eliminando distracciones y ayudando a mantener el enfoque durante las tareas.

  • ¿Cómo puede ayudar preparar una lista de tareas antes de empezar a trabajar?

    -Preparar una lista de tareas antes de comenzar te ayuda a enfocarte en las prioridades del día. Es una forma efectiva de organizar tu tiempo, reducir la procrastinación y ver al final del día el progreso logrado.

  • ¿Por qué es importante programar descansos durante tu jornada de trabajo?

    -Programar descansos mejora la concentración y ayuda a prevenir el agotamiento mental y físico. Levantarse, estirarse o dar un paseo corto puede rejuvenecer tu mente, permitiéndote trabajar de manera más eficiente.

  • ¿Cómo mantener ordenado el escritorio digital y por qué es importante?

    -Mantener el escritorio digital limpio y organizado ayuda a reducir distracciones. Eliminar archivos innecesarios, organizar carpetas y cerrar aplicaciones no utilizadas permite acceder a lo que necesitas rápidamente, facilitando la productividad.

  • ¿Qué beneficios tiene hacer algo pequeño cada día en la programación?

    -Hacer algo pequeño cada día, aunque no sea un gran proyecto, permite avanzar de manera constante. La consistencia, incluso con pequeñas tareas, te ayuda a lograr grandes resultados con el tiempo.

  • ¿Por qué es importante revisar y limpiar tu código antes de terminar?

    -Revisar y limpiar tu código mejora su calidad, facilita su comprensión tanto para ti como para otros programadores, y ayuda a mantener buenas prácticas. También refuerza lo aprendido y permite detectar áreas de mejora.

  • ¿Cuál es el propósito de tomar notas sobre lo que aprendes al programar?

    -Tomar notas ayuda a retener y aplicar conceptos clave, errores comunes y soluciones. Estas notas funcionan como un manual de referencia rápida, y también actúan como un 'cerebro secundario' para facilitar el aprendizaje continuo.

  • ¿Por qué es importante aprender los atajos de teclado en el editor de código?

    -Aprender atajos de teclado en tu editor de código optimiza tu flujo de trabajo, ahorrando tiempo y mejorando la eficiencia. Los atajos ayudan a realizar tareas de manera más rápida y fluida, lo que mejora la productividad.

  • ¿Qué ventajas tiene leer el código de otras personas?

    -Leer el código de otras personas te permite aprender nuevas formas de resolver problemas, conocer diferentes estilos y ampliar tu visión como programador. Esto también te ayuda a aprender nuevas herramientas, lenguajes o marcos de trabajo.

  • ¿Cómo puede celebrar tus logros como programador mejorar tu motivación?

    -Celebrar tus logros, por pequeños que sean, refuerza la motivación y combate el síndrome del impostor. Reconocer tus avances te hace sentir que estás progresando, lo que te impulsa a continuar aprendiendo y superando desafíos.

Outlines

plate

Этот раздел доступен только подписчикам платных тарифов. Пожалуйста, перейдите на платный тариф для доступа.

Перейти на платный тариф

Mindmap

plate

Этот раздел доступен только подписчикам платных тарифов. Пожалуйста, перейдите на платный тариф для доступа.

Перейти на платный тариф

Keywords

plate

Этот раздел доступен только подписчикам платных тарифов. Пожалуйста, перейдите на платный тариф для доступа.

Перейти на платный тариф

Highlights

plate

Этот раздел доступен только подписчикам платных тарифов. Пожалуйста, перейдите на платный тариф для доступа.

Перейти на платный тариф

Transcripts

plate

Этот раздел доступен только подписчикам платных тарифов. Пожалуйста, перейдите на платный тариф для доступа.

Перейти на платный тариф
Rate This

5.0 / 5 (0 votes)

Связанные теги
ProductividadProgramaciónHábitosDesarrollo personalMotivaciónConsejos de codificaciónAutomatizaciónTrabajo remotoDesarrollo de softwareProductividad diariaAprendizaje continuo
Вам нужно краткое изложение на английском?